Which are Extra Strength Naturally Hl Warming Ice UNII Codes?
The UNII codes for the active ingredients in this product are:
- LIDOCAINE HYDROCHLORIDE (UNII: V13007Z41A)
- LIDOCAINE (UNII: 98PI200987) (Active Moiety)
Which are Extra Strength Naturally Hl Warming Ice Inactive Ingredients UNII Codes?
The inactive ingredients are all the component of a medicinal product OTHER than the active ingredient(s). The acronym "UNII" stands for “Unique Ingredient Identifier” and is used to identify each inactive ingredient present in a product. The UNII codes for the inactive ingredients in this product are:
- BEHENTRIMONIUM METHOSULFATE (UNII: 5SHP745C61)
- BLACK PEPPER OIL (UNII: U17J84S19Z)
- GRAPE SEED OIL (UNII: 930MLC8XGG)
- EUCALYPTUS OIL (UNII: 2R04ONI662)
- OLIVE OIL (UNII: 6UYK2W1W1E)
- WHITE WAX (UNII: 7G1J5DA97F)
- COCOA BUTTER (UNII: 512OYT1CRR)
- ALOE VERA WHOLE (UNII: KIZ4X2EHYX)
What is the NDC to RxNorm Crosswalk for Extra Strength Naturally Hl Warming Ice?
- RxCUI: 1010895 - lidocaine HCl 4 % Topical Cream
- RxCUI: 1010895 - lidocaine hydrochloride 40 MG/ML Topical Cream
- RxCUI: 1010895 - lidocaine hydrochloride 4 % Topical Cream
